10 years 1 week ago #42530 by salmson
Munster squad update: www.munsterrugby.ie/news/22429.php#.Vw0Fj0Zl2Nh

BJ Botha , Mark Chisholm, Tyler Bleyendaal, Denis Hurley, Kevin O'Byrne, Dave Foley, Mario Sagario, Sean McCarthy and Peter O'Mahony out.

Duncan Casey is available and Dave O'Callaghan & Donncha Ryan are touch and go.

10 years 1 week ago #42526 by salmson
Out for season:
Jake Heenan (likely), Nepia Fox-Matamua, Eoghan Masterson, Dave McSharry, Darragh Leader.

Out for Munster (at least):
McGinty, TOH, Poolman, Ronaldson.

Returning:
Carty, Parata.

Unknown/no update:
Caolin Blade, Ciaran Gaffney, Ben Marshall, Api Pewhairangi, Ian Porter, Nathan White.
